Landslide susceptibility is the likelihood of a landslide occurring in an area on the basis of local terrain condition to estimate “where” landslides are likely to occur. This resource includes a Jupyter Notebook to demonstrate how to use several CSDMS data components (https://csdms.colorado.edu/wiki/DataComponents) to download topography and soil datasets to calculate the hourly landslide susceptibility for a study area in Puerto Rico when Hurricane Maria hit the island on September 20th, 2017.
